The Smart Secure Locker is a multilevel bank security system that uses face recognition via SVM, fingerprint scanning, and password verification for robust access control. It starts with face authentication on a laptop, followed by fingerprint and password checks through Arduino. If all steps are successful, the locker unlocks with an indicator. Any failure triggers a buzzer alarm and alerts bank authorities. This system ensures real-time monitoring and protection against cyber threats, biometric spoofing, and password breaches. By combining machine learning and hardware, it offers tamper-proof, automated, and highly secure locker access.

The Bru-Reang Displaced crisis of North-East India is a two-decade-old which emerged out from the ethnic strife between the Mizo and Bru populations in Mizoram, consequently leading to the exodus of over 30,000 people to Tripura. From settling in relief camps in Tripura to the series of attempts of repatriation to Mizoram and the changes that occurred along the way to finally be given permanent settlement in Tripura involves the path of much event issues and problems that attracted the notice of news outlets, government officials, and ministries in the country. The paper seeks the causes of unsuccessful repatriation attempts taken, and illustrating the complexity of permanent settlement solution, with Mizoram and Tripura's states responsibility in handling the situation are closely evaluated in this paper. With the 2020 Quadruple Accord, initiated by the central government and negotiated by the two states governments of Tripura and Mizoram, the Bru dispute was supposed to have been obstacle free from any further difficulties. But the several challenges and complexities faced during the implementation phase caused the permanent resettlement to be postponed beyond the expected period. The study also assesses the living circumstances, social-economic integration, and Bru population adaption in many recently founded settlement colonies. The study and descriptions collected from interviews with displaced Bru representatives, field observations, media reports, papers, and scholarly sources help to offer a thorough knowledge of the problem from many dimension perspectives.

AI-powered visual content moderation systems play a crucial role in maintaining digital safety and integrity. These systems employ advanced machine learning, computer vision, and deep learning algorithms to analyze and filter images and videos based on predefined standards. By recognizing objects, scenes, and facial expressions, AI moderators can detect explicit, harmful, or misleading content. Additionally, metadata and text extraction aid in understanding contextual elements within multimedia files. While AI moderation offers efficiency and scalability, it faces challenges such as bias, false positives, and contextual misinterpretation. Ethical concerns, including privacy and censorship, necessitate continuous refinement and human oversight to ensure fairness and accuracy in automated moderation. As AI technology evolves, integrating improved models and diverse datasets will help create more responsible and adaptable content moderation frameworks.

Transcranial Direct Current Stimulation (tDCS) is a non-invasive brain stimulation that can improve the limb's motor function by remote modifications in the central motor system. Bilateral Arm training (BAT) involves use of the affected arm which is in association with the unaffected arm that initiate interlimb coupling, which mitigates interhemispheric inhibition and in turn helps improving affected limb function. The current paper presents the protocol for conducting research into the efficacy of Transcranial Direct current stimulation and Bilateral Arm Training on neurological upper limb impairments. A single blind randomized clinical trial will be conducted involving Transcranial Direct current stimulation and Bilateral Arm Training on 20 individuals with neurological upper limb impairments. The group A intervention consists of Bihemispheric stimulation of 1 mA for 20 minutes while group B will receive Bilateral arm training along with convention therapy in both the groups for a total duration of 50 minutes. Participants of the assigned group will receive 10 sessions of treatment over 2 weeks. Outcomes used will be subjective Pre and post-treatment assessments will be done using Wolf Motor Function Test (WMFT) and Fugyl Meyer assessment-upper extremity (FMA-UE).

The village-fringe mangroves of the Sundarbans serve as crucial bio-shields against storms, surges, and erosion. However, long-term unsustainable resource use and hydro-geomorphic changes have degraded these ecosystems. Cyclone Bulbul (9th November 2019), with 119 km/h winds, caused widespread damage. This study analyses its impact on vegetation and canopy gaps across five village-fringe sites in the south-western Sundarbans using Landsat-8 data. Dense canopies were severely degraded, especially in North-Bakkhali and Shikarpur, while Dwarikanagar saw lesser impact but signs of vegetation decline. The findings highlight the urgent need for periodic, site-specific monitoring and sustainable management to restore and protect the ecological health of these vulnerable mangrove zones.

This study explores the impact of flexible work policies on women's career development in the Indian corporate sector. It investigates how perceived flexibility influences job satisfaction, career progression, promotion likelihood, and workforce retention among women in desk-based roles. Using a structured questionnaire, data was collected from 120 respondents across multiple industries. A quantitative research design was chosen to ensure objective analysis of multiple variables using descriptive and inferential statistics. The study is grounded in the Job Demands-Resources (JD-R) model and Conservation of Resources (COR) theory to examine how flexibility as a resource influences motivation and long-term career investment. Hypothesis testing was conducted using linear regression, independent samples t-test, mediation analysis, chi-square, and logistic regression. The findings suggest that flexible work significantly enhances job satisfaction and perceived career growth, mediated by work-life balance. However, flexibility does not show significant statistical correlation with actual promotions or retention intent. These results suggest that while flexibility is a valuable resource, structural barriers still affect career advancement. The paper provides insights for policy-makers and HR professionals to develop more inclusive workplace policies.
